What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in the East Dallas real estate market?

Professionals in the East Dallas real estate market often encounter challenges such as navigating a highly competitive housing market, keeping up with rapidly changing neighborhood trends, and meeting the diverse needs of both buyers and sellers. The area's popularity can lead to bidding wars and the need for quick decision-making, which requires strong negotiation and communication skills. Additionally, staying updated on local zoning regulations and community developments is essential for success in this dynamic environment.

What is an East Dallas?

East Dallas jobs refer to employment opportunities located in the East Dallas area of Dallas, Texas. These roles can span various industries such as healthcare, education, retail, hospitality, and technology, reflecting the diverse economy of the neighborhood. Job seekers in East Dallas may find positions with local businesses, schools, hospitals, or larger corporations with offices in the area. The job market in East Dallas often benefits from the community's growth, proximity to downtown Dallas, and vibrant local culture.
